Key Features to Look For

Choosing a light meter can seem tricky. Here are some important features to consider:

  • PAR (Photosynthetically Active Radiation) Measurement: This is the most important feature. PAR measures the light plants use for photosynthesis. Look for a meter that specifically measures PAR. This is what your plants need!
  • Light Range: Make sure the light meter can measure the light levels produced by your LED grow lights. LED lights can be very bright. The meter needs a wide range.
  • Accuracy: You want a meter that gives you correct readings. Check reviews to see if other users find it accurate.
  • Display: A clear and easy-to-read display is important. Digital displays are usually easier to read.
  • Durability: Grow rooms can be humid. Choose a light meter that is sturdy and can handle some moisture.
  • Portability: A small and lightweight meter is easy to move around. You can measure light in different parts of your grow space.

User Experience and Use Cases

Using a light meter is simple. Here’s how it helps:

  • Placement: Hold the meter near your plants. This helps you measure the light they receive.
  • Adjusting Light: Use the meter to adjust the height of your LED grow lights. You can move the lights closer or further away to get the right light level.
  • Comparing Lights: You can compare different LED grow lights. This helps you choose the best lights for your plants.
  • Troubleshooting: If your plants are not growing well, a light meter can help. You can check if they are getting enough light.
  • Documentation: Keep a record of your light readings. This helps you track your progress.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Why do I need a light meter for LED grow lights?

A: You need a light meter to make sure your plants get the correct amount of light. Too much or too little light can be bad.

Q: What is PAR?

A: PAR stands for Photosynthetically Active Radiation. It measures the light plants use for growth.

Q: What is the difference between PAR and LUX?

A: LUX measures overall light intensity. PAR is a more specific measurement for plants. PAR is generally better.

Q: How do I use a light meter?

A: Hold the sensor near your plants. Take readings at different spots and heights.

Q: How often should I calibrate my light meter?

A: Read the instructions. Some meters need calibration yearly. Others need it more or less.

Q: What light intensity is best for my plants?

A: The best light intensity depends on the plant. Research the needs of your specific plants.

Q: What if my light meter gives different readings in different spots?

A: This means the light isn’t evenly distributed. Adjust your light position or add more lights.
